 @font-face{font-family:'Noto Sans';src:url('//media.invisioncic.com/h330125/set_resources_9/6d538d11ecfced46f459ee300b5e80ec_noto-sans-400.woff2') format('woff2');font-weight:400;font-display:swap;}@font-face{font-family:'Noto Sans';src:url('//media.invisioncic.com/h330125/set_resources_9/6d538d11ecfced46f459ee300b5e80ec_noto-sans-500.woff2') format('woff2');font-weight:500;font-display:swap;}@font-face{font-family:'Noto Sans';src:url('//media.invisioncic.com/h330125/set_resources_9/6d538d11ecfced46f459ee300b5e80ec_noto-sans-600.woff2') format('woff2');font-weight:600;font-display:swap;}@font-face{font-family:'Noto Sans';src:url('//media.invisioncic.com/h330125/set_resources_9/6d538d11ecfced46f459ee300b5e80ec_noto-sans-700.woff2') format('woff2');font-weight:700;font-display:swap;}body, .ipsLogo{font-family:'Noto Sans', var(--i-font-family);}h1, h2, h3, h4, h5, h6{font-family:"Noto Serif", serif;}[data-pagename="index-new"] [data-stattype="num_views"]{display:none !important;}.ipsLayout__main .ipsWidth:has(.bsi-layout--guests){max-width:100%;}.ipsWidget:has(.ipsWidget__reset){background:transparent;box-shadow:none;border-width:0;}.bsi_footer img{max-height:56px;margin:1em 0;}.ipsAreaBackground_dark{background:#24262e;color:#fff;}.ipsAreaBackground_dark .bsi-welcome-box__btn{background:#FBFBFB;color:#111;}[data-ips-guest] .ipsFooter{margin-top:-42px;}.top-bar{background:#C5C5C5;color:#fff;font-size:15px;}.top-bar a{color:inherit;}.top-bar a:hover{text-decoration:underline;}.top-bar__links{margin:0;padding:6px;list-style:none;min-height:50px;display:flex;align-items:center;justify-content:flex-end;gap:10px 30px;}.top-bar__links img{max-width:100%;max-height:50px;}@media (max-width:979px){.top-bar{display:none;}}[data-pagename="index"] [data-stattype="num_views"], [data-pagename="index"] [data-stattype="views"]{display:none;}.ipsPhotoPanel__secondary:not(.ipsPhotoPanel__secondary--no_views), [data-stattype="num_views"], [data-stattype="downloads"], [data-ips-hook="downloadsFileStats"] li:has(.fa-solid.fa-eye){display:none !important;}.bsi-welcome-box__buttons{margin-top:1em;display:flex;flex-wrap:wrap;gap:1em;}.bsi-welcome-box__btn{display:inline-block;padding:10px 34px !important;line-height:1.5 !important;background:#FBFBFB;color:#111;border-radius:8px;}